Objective: Develop a template to understand the intricacies of our data, starting with Excel files, to provide meaningful insights for business analysts and data engineers. This template should guide the data profiling process, ensuring that the most relevant information is captured to support data quality and decision-making.
Questions to Explore:
- What types of profiling data (e.g., missing values, data types, formulas, and inconsistencies) are important for understanding the content and quality of Excel files?
- How can we capture these data points in a structured and consistent way to help identify patterns, anomalies, and areas requiring further attention?
- What should the template include to provide actionable insights for business analysts and ensure seamless collaboration with data engineers?
